Chemical Identifiers

CAS 10099-74-8
Molecular Formula N2O6Pb
Molecular Weight (g/mol) 331.20
MDL Number MFCD00011153
InChI Key RLJMLMKIBZAXJO-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Synonym lead dinitrate, lead nitrate, lead ii nitrate, plumbous nitrate, lead 2+ nitrate, lead nitrate pb no3 2, nitrate de plomb french, lead ii nitrate 1:2, nitric acid, lead 2+ salt
PubChem CID 24924
ChEBI CHEBI:37187
IUPAC Name λ²-lead(2+) dinitrate
SMILES [Pb++].[O-][N+]([O-])=O.[O-][N+]([O-])=O

Specifications

Melting Point 470°C
Color White
pH 3 to 4
Physical Form Solid

Product Identifier
  • Lead(II) nitrate
Signal Word
  • Danger
Hazard Category
  • Oxidising solid Category 2
  • Acute toxicity Category 4
  • Specific target organ toxicity after repeated exposure Category 2
  • Reproductive toxicity Category 1A
  • Serious eye damage/eye irritation Category 1
  • ACUTE AQUATIC Acute 1
  • LONG-TERM AQUATIC HAZARD Chronic 1
Hazard Statement
  • H272-May intensify fire; oxidiser.
  • H332-Harmful if inhaled.
  • H373-May cause damage to organs.
  • H302-Harmful if swallowed.
  • H360Df-May damage the unborn child. Suspected of damaging fertility.
  • H318-Causes serious eye damage.
  • H410-Very toxic to aquatic life with long lasting effects.
  • EUH201-Contains lead. Should not be used on surfaces liable to be chewed or sucked by children.
Precautionary Statement
  • P210-Keep away from heat, hot surfaces, sparks, open flames and other ignition sources. No smoking.
  • P280-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ection.
  • P260-Do not breathe dust/fume/gas/mist/vapours/spray.
  • P273-Avoid release to the environment.
  • P301+P312-IF SWALLOWED: Call a POISON CENTER or doctor/physician/ if you feel unwell.
  • P304+P340-IF INHALED: Remove person to fresh air and keep comfortable for breathing.
